Hi Kerrie,
The best thing to do is to do a TEFL course or if you have £1000, you can do the CELTA (the Internationally recognised teaching English qualification).

With either one of these you shouldn't have any problems getting a job in Algeria as a teacher in a private school. I would be very cautious about considering teaching in people's homes or inviting them to yours due as a foreigner and your security.

Dear Kerry,
The British Centre is a private English school which had been running for years but I don't know if it still is. Although it is called the British Centre, it isn't officially attched to the Embassy or the British Council.

The British Council have recently re-opened in Algiers although they are providing a supportive network to teachers of English and are not working as a school. To work there you will need the CELTA or equivalent, the TEFL is not sufficient.
